Final Reports, Recommendations Laura Tharney February 10, 2020 towing, ...In the case of an involuntary or police-ordered tow from private property, Massachusetts towing companies can charge a maximum towing rate of $108. In the case of an involuntary tow, Massachusetts towing companies can charge a maximum storage rate of $35 per 24-hour period. As of Jan. 1, 2018, a tower needs to get signed authorization from the owner of the parking lot before towing the vehicle. The tower needs to keep a copy of the signed authorization for at least two years and provide a copy upon request at no additional charge.
